Because your post is in "Networking" versus "Wireless Networking" I am led to believe you are both using "wired" connections. Correct?
Has he ever had faster DL speed? At his home or at yours? What AV software is in use - what happens to DL speeds if the AV is stopped?
That said, has he checked that he has up-to-date drivers for his ethernet card? Or has there been an recent driver update? Maybe the newer driver has a problem of some sort - especially if he has had higher DL speeds in the past.
Device Manager shows many possible settings/configurations for installed network adapters. Has there been any known "tweaking" in hopes of gaining improved performance or speeds?
Suggest that you post the Make and Model of his network adapter - someone may recognize the problem accordingly.
As for his machine being "better" that can be a relative issue. Performance is driven by a variety of factors. He may not have control of some existing "bottleneck".
